LeicaPassion Posted September 14, 2014 Share #25 Â Posted September 14, 2014 I just received the micro lens pouch. They're great. Regarding size: medium fits the 50 APO and 21 SuperElmar and the large fits the 28 cron, 35 lux (a bit roomy), and 90 APO. Link to post Share on other sites More sharing options...

LeicaPassion Posted September 15, 2014 Share #28 Â Posted September 15, 2014 Semi-Ambivalent, Medium should work. Leica-provided dimensions for the 35 cron are 53 x 34.5 compared to the 50 APO's 53 x 47. That said, I don't know if the dimensions include the lens hood for the 35 cron. Â I would give it a try and make sure I could return the lens cases. Perhaps someone with the 35 cron and the medium case could provide a definitive answer.
